The Snapdragon 888 is Qualcomm's latest premium CPU for smartphones
The company is announcing today that its latest premium mobile chipset is the Snapdragon 888, and it’ll be in Xiaomi’s upcoming Mi 11 flagship. Other companies like LG, OnePlus, Motorola, ASUS, Lenovo and Oppo have “provided their support for Snapdragon 888,” Qualcomm said.

Qualcomm's Quick Charge 5 promises more power and super fast speeds
It’s been three years since Qualcomm last announced a new generation of its Quick Charge technology, and the company has updates today that might make juicing up your phones even breezier than before. Quick Charge 5 promises to charge devices to 50 percent in just 5 minutes, and supports more than 100W of charging power in a smartphone, which the company says is the first time for a “commercially viable fast charging platform.” While Qualcomm didn’t specify a battery size in its claim, footnotes in the company’s press release state that it ran tests on a 4,500mAh cell.
